Part 2: Week 1 Assignment Part 2: Problem Statement and Research Question(s)

Directions:

Based on your meeting with your colleague and the readings from the textbook, identify your problem to research. Then, the next step is to “convert” it into a problem statement. The problem statement is a reiteration of the research problem as a complete sentence. The purpose of the problem statement is to guide your study. Refer to the examples in the text. The research statement is the fundamental question inherent in the research topic. It serves as the main guide to the study. The research questions should begin with the word
how or what. Do not assume results in the questions. Ask questions that can be answered with data. Write a problem statement followed by your research question(s).
